My 2002 xg350 won't turn over. I just took it in with the same problem and the shoop said it was the alternator (which had been replaced last year). Now its happening again. I have full power, and jumping doesn't solve it. I checked the battery at autozoen and they said it was fine. I even checked the voltage which reads at 12.85v so well abouve what is needed to turn over the starter. any ideas as to what could be causing this. I don't hear the starter solenoid clicking, but it could just be really quite, as i have to turn the key from inside. Thanks

not that simple. It started again. but then failed the next time. I'm thinking starter is going. It seems to be more of a problem when temp is high either from driving or sun. I thought it might be the ignition switch, but when i turn it the electronics all respond (i.e. the dash lights and radio turn off momentarily), and i've heard of this kind of thing on other vehicles.
